An insulated receptacle specifically designed to maintain the temperature of pizzas during transportation is essential for food delivery services. These bags, often constructed from durable, heat-reflective materials, ensure that the product arrives at its destination in optimal condition. For instance, a properly insulated carrier can keep a pizza hot and fresh for up to an hour, preventing sogginess and maintaining flavor.
The use of temperature-controlled carriers is crucial for preserving food quality and customer satisfaction. By preventing heat loss, these solutions minimize the risk of bacterial growth and maintain the intended texture of the food. Historically, rudimentary methods were employed to keep items warm, but advancements in material science and design have led to sophisticated products that offer superior thermal performance. This evolution has directly impacted the efficiency and reliability of the food delivery industry.
